2nd lap run. You need to come out the last turns good to cross the start already doing around 137kph. Keep it in 4th up to 141kph and change to 5th if approaching downhill at that speed. On any uphills, change down to 4th before you lose speed (so change to 4th at 143kph) and that'll allow you to maintain 140kph+ speed on the uphills or turns. I'm constantly jumping between4th and 5th in that magic 140-143mph zone to maintain speed.@TheNormsk how are you guys getting below 1'53.000? Wow, I was lucky I got a lap time in the 1'59.000 range.
